Diablo fans rejoice! The rumored third game has finally been announced. Blizzard recently made the announcement at its event in Paris.
The story is set 20 years after the likes of Diablo and Baal. It has been revealed that one of the well-known non-playing characters will return in Diablo III, Decard Cain. Cain returns to the remains of the Cathedral of Tristram, searching for ideas as to a new evil that seems to be approaching. Following that, a comet hit ground where Diablo once entered the world… Heroes of the world must now save humanity from the great evils that have arisen from the underworld.

Two classes of characters have been confirmed at this point in time. There will be female versions of each class, as well, and armor will be specific to each character class.
The barbarian is back and comes with fury and some other familiar characteristics. Other abilities have been added or revamped. A few of his known skills include the ground stomp, leap, whirlwind, seismic slam and cleave.
The witch doctor is one of the newly added character classes in this sequel. His tribe is the tribe of the Five Hills. These people were thought to be legend, but they do exist. The witch doctor has the power to summon undead creatures to literally tear apart his enemies. His (or her) skill set includes the firebomb, locust swarm, mass confusion, soul harvest and horrify.

The Undead will again rise along with the following enemies that must be fought off: the Khazra, Gnarled Walkers and Dark Cultists. The Undead are skeletons that have risen up from various parts of other former living and breathing beings. They are easily summoned if pieces of skeletons lie around. They can be ‘organized and directed’, unlike other types of enemies. Also known as ‘goatmen’, the Khazra were originally human but sought only to prevail over other adversaries and now only partially resemble the semblance of a human being.
Various enhancements have been made to the game overall. A new dropped item is an orb of life, which is supposed to save you from having to click a potion to heal when in the heat of battle. This should make things interesting. The mana and vita bars are more animated and look cool. A hotbar to easily choose different skills is now available, making it much quicker. The mouse can be used to quickly switch between skills. The game seems to be more colorful than I remember Diablo 2 being. Case in point, the barbarian may be using an axe with lightning and it is lit up with blue and white flickering animation. The visuals that I’ve seen from the trailer (of cutscenes) are astounding, with the candle looking almost indistinguishable from the real thing. The glimmering reddish-orange light emanates from the wick while the wax slowly melts. The environmental aspects of the game will come more into play in Diablo III, such as massive walls being destroyed. Oh, and the game will be represented in 3D this time around!
